    In:  Journal of Marketing Vol. 87, No. 4 ( 2023-07), p. 528-549
    In: Journal of Marketing, SAGE Publications, Vol. 87, No. 4 ( 2023-07), p. 528-549
    Abstract: This study examines how the timing of review reminders affects the likelihood and quality of product review postings. The authors postulate that review reminders have two distinct effects, depending on the delivery timing. On the one hand, reminders of review posting given immediately or shortly after a product experience may threaten a consumer's freedom and prompt an adverse reaction. On the other hand, as time after the product experience passes, it may be advantageous to revive memories of review posting using delayed review reminders. To evaluate the effect of review reminders, the authors conduct two randomized field experiments. The findings show that immediate reminders reduce the chance of review postings relative to a randomized immediate control group who did not receive a reminder, consistent with the notion that the reactance induced by the violation of freedom due to instant review reminders outweighs the benefit of memory recall. Conversely, delayed reminders significantly increase the likelihood of review posting compared with a randomized delayed control, suggesting that the memory recall benefit surpasses reactance. However, the timing of review reminders has little effect on review content. The study contributes to the literature on the temporal effects of marketing activities and provides practical advice for online marketplaces to collect more product reviews.

    In:  International Journal of Environmental Research and Public Health Vol. 16, No. 16 ( 2019-08-19), p. 2983-
    In: International Journal of Environmental Research and Public Health, MDPI AG, Vol. 16, No. 16 ( 2019-08-19), p. 2983-
    Abstract: Exposure to air pollution affects human activity and health. Particularly, in Asian countries, the influence of particulate matter on humans has received wide attention. However, there is still a lack of research about the effects of particulate matter on human outdoor activities and mental health. Therefore, we aimed to explore the association between exposure to particulate matter with a diameter of less than 10 µm (PM10) and outdoor activity along with mental health in South Korea where issues caused by particulate matter increasingly have social and economic impacts. We examined this relationship by combining the physical and habitual factors of approximately 100,000 people in 2015 from the Korean National Health Survey. To measure each individual’s exposure to particulate matter, we computed the total hours exposed to a high PM10 concentration ( 〉 80 μg/m3) in a given district one month before the survey was conducted. After dividing all districts into six groups according to the exposed level of the high PM10, we applied the propensity score-weighting method to control for observable background characteristics. We then estimated the impact of the high PM10 on outdoor activity and mental health between the weighted individuals in each group. Our main findings suggest that the impact of PM10 on outdoor activity and stress shows an inverted-U shaped function, which is counterintuitive. Specifically, both outdoor activity and stress levels tend to be worsened when the exposure time to a high PM10 ( 〉 80 μg/m3) was more than 20 h. Related policy implications are discussed.

    In:  Production and Operations Management Vol. 30, No. 8 ( 2021-08), p. 2586-2607
    In: Production and Operations Management, Wiley, Vol. 30, No. 8 ( 2021-08), p. 2586-2607
    Abstract: Our study aims to deepen the understanding of personalized digital nudges by evaluating their effects on energy‐saving behavior. We conducted a field experiment with a leading smart metering company in South Korea to investigate whether customers save more energy when a personalized goal and feedback are provided, and how the impacts of nudges vary according to the types of misperception. Specifically, we focused on the behavior of customers who underestimate or overestimate their past electricity usage compared to their actual consumption. We merged daily energy consumption with a pre‐experiment survey for the customers. We found that goal‐setting and feedback mechanisms have a markedly different impact on each type of misperception. Underestimating customers reduced energy consumption only under the “goal‐setting with feedback" treatment. Conversely, overestimating customers reduced energy consumption even under the “goal‐setting without feedback" condition. The underlying mechanism is suggested as updating biased beliefs toward goal achievement. Overall, the results demonstrate that personalized nudges lead to heterogeneous behavioral responses and that service providers and policymakers can use these signals to enrich their planning of behavioral nudges.

    In: Journal of Medical Internet Research, JMIR Publications Inc., Vol. 21, No. 9 ( 2019-09-06), p. e13463-
    Abstract: Although distress screening is crucial for cancer survivors, it is not easy for clinicians to recognize distress. Physical activity (PA) data collected by mobile devices such as smart bands and smartphone apps have the potential to be used to screen distress in breast cancer survivors. Objective The aim of this study was to assess data collection rates of smartphone apps and smart bands in terms of PA data, investigate the correlation between PA data from mobile devices and distress-related questionnaires from smartphone apps, and demonstrate factors associated with data collection with smart bands and smartphone apps in breast cancer survivors. Methods In this prospective observational study, patients who underwent surgery for breast cancer at Asan Medical Center, Seoul, Republic of Korea, between June 2017 and March 2018 were enrolled and asked to use both a smartphone app and smart band for 6 months. The overall compliance rates of the daily PA data collection via the smartphone walking apps and wearable smart bands were analyzed in a within-subject manner. The longitudinal daily collection rates were calculated to examine the dropout pattern. We also performed multivariate linear regression analysis to examine factors associated with compliance with daily collection. Finally, we tested the correlation between the count of daily average steps and distress level using Pearson correlation analysis. Results A total of 160 female patients who underwent breast cancer surgeries were enrolled. The overall compliance rates for using a smartphone app and smart bands were 88.0% (24,224/27,513) and 52.5% (14,431/27,513), respectively. The longitudinal compliance rate for smartphone apps was 77.8% at day 180, while the longitudinal compliance rate for smart bands rapidly decreased over time, reaching 17.5% at day 180. Subjects who were young, with other comorbidities, or receiving antihormonal therapy or targeted therapy showed significantly higher compliance rates to the smartphone app. However, no factor was associated with the compliance rate to the smart band. In terms of the correlation between the count of daily steps and distress level, step counts collected via smart band showed a significant correlation with distress level. Conclusions Smartphone apps or smart bands are feasible tools to collect data on the physical activity of breast cancer survivors. PA data from mobile devices are correlated with participants’ distress data, which suggests the potential role of mobile devices in the management of distress in breast cancer survivors.     In: JMIR mHealth and uHealth, JMIR Publications Inc., Vol. 8, No. 5 ( 2020-5-4), p. e17320-
    Abstract: Electronic patient-reported outcome (PROs) provides a fast and reliable assessment of a patient’s health-related quality of life. Nevertheless, using PRO in the traditional paper format is not practical for clinical practice due to the limitations associated with data analysis and management. A questionnaire app was developed to address the need for a practical way to group and use distress and physical activity assessment tools. Objective The purpose of this study was to assess the level of agreement between electronic (mobile) and paper-and-pencil questionnaire responses. Methods We validated the app version of the distress thermometer (DT), International Physical Activity Questionnaire (IPAQ), and Patient Health Questionnaire–9 (PHQ-9). A total of 102 participants answered the paper and app versions of the DT and IPAQ, and 96 people completed the PHQ-9. The study outcomes were the correlation of the data between the paper-and-pencil and app versions. Results A total of 106 consecutive breast cancer patients were enrolled and analyzed for validation of paper and electronic (app) versions. The Spearman correlation values of paper and app surveys for patients who responded to the DT questionnaire within 7 days, within 3 days, and on the same day were .415 (P 〈 .001), .437 (P 〈 .001), and .603 (P 〈 .001), respectively. Similarly, the paper and app survey correlation values of the IPAQ total physical activity metabolic equivalent of task (MET; Q2-6) were .291 (P=.003), .324 (P=.005), and .427 (P=.01), respectively. The correlation of the sum of the Patient Health Questionnaire–9 (Q1-9) according to the time interval between the paper-based questionnaire and the app-based questionnaire was .469 for 14 days (P 〈 .001), .574 for 7 days (P 〈 .001), .593 for 3 days (P 〈 .001), and .512 for the same day (P=.03). These were all statistically significant. Similarly, the correlation of the PHQ (Q10) value according to the time interval between the paper-based questionnaire and the app-based questionnaire was .283 for 14 days (P=.005), .409 for 7 days (P=.001), .415 for 3 days (P=.009), and .736 for the same day (P=.001). These were all statistically significant. In the overall trend, the shorter the interval between the paper-and-pencil questionnaire and the app-based questionnaire, the higher the correlation value. Conclusions The app version of the distress and physical activity questionnaires has shown validity and a high level of association with the paper-based DT, IPAQ (Q2-6), and PHQ-9. The app-based questionnaires were not inferior to their respective paper versions and confirm the feasibility for their use in clinical practice. The high correlation between paper and mobile app data allows the use of new mobile apps to benefit the overall health care system.
